
The Secretariat for Comprehensive Risk Management and Civil Protection (SGIRPC) from Mexico City reported that the falling temperatures caused by the Cold front number 25 will end next Thursday, January 1, 2026.
According to him special note issued by the Capital Agency on December 30 and 31, 2025, as well as the January 1, 2026the nation’s capital will experience one cold to very cold environmentespecially in the early morning hours.
Authorities said the minimum temperatures would be in the early morning hours between 1 and 6 degrees Celsiuswith probability Frost at high altitudes the city.
This period of low temperatures represents the most intense phase of the phenomenon thermal waste The most important one is planned for the early hours of the morning December 31st.
It’s in the afternoon atmosphere It will be milder to warmer, with maximum values between 17 and 22 degrees Celsius.
They were also able to register occasional light rainalthough meteorological conditions will tend to stabilize towards the end of the said period.
Out of January 1stIt is expected that the climatic conditions begin to normalize and the associated thermal decline Cold front number 25 ends his influence on the capital.
The capital agency started differently Recommendations to the population to take preventative measures during this period, especially during the year-end celebrations.
Among the Suggestions exhibited highlight:
- Cover yourself appropriately with layers of comfortable clothing.
- Cover your mouth and nose to avoid breathing in cold air.
- Eat a balanced diet, consume fruits, vegetables, liquids and hot drinks.
- If heaters are used, ensure the home is well ventilated to avoid carbon monoxide poisoning.
- Avoid using fireworks during celebrations.
- Identify the health modules and go to them if you feel any discomfort.
The capital agency reiterated the importance of prevention, especially for vulnerable groups such as minors, older adults and people with respiratory diseases.
In addition, he reminded citizens to pay attention to and use official communications Health Services in case of symptoms related to low temperatures.
